This video is the first of a series where we take a look behind the scene of how WeatherWool is made. Eventually, we'll go all the way back to the shearing of the sheep, but we wanted to get right into the heart of the process and show you how the wool is woven. (It also happened to be the next step on the to-do list.)
In this episode, we feature Material Technology and Logistics based in Jessup, PA, USA.
